  • Are there any limits to how many items I can have?

    During the 14-day free trial there are no limits. If you choose to remain on the Celerly Basic or Celerly Pro plan, there are no limits.* However if you choose to default to the free plan, there is a 100 item cap. We don't delete your items if you've gone over the 100 item cap but to add new items you'll need to remove enough to get below the cap, or upgrade to a paid plan. 

    * Like everything...there are limits...a 30,000 item baseball card collection? Let's talk. This product is still in Beta so we're developing features but there are likely better tools out there for this type of inventory. We currently are not capping items but do monitor system load.

  • Can I customize the Crunch it! Cacluator?

    Yes, there are many ways  you can tailor the Crunch it! Calculator to your specific resell business. First, by default we assume the eBay marketplace in our, “bite” calculation. This is because eBay is one of the higher fee platforms. Change the numbers under your own personal preferences. It doesn’t back update but going forward any new Crunch it! will use your new numbers. 

    It’s good to keep in mind…the Crunch it! Calculator is a guide. You ultimately decide what to buy and sell. That’s what makes this business fun. The goal of the Crunch it! Calculator is simply to give pause. Let you see the numbers…see if they meet  your threshold (another number you can adjust in your preferences.)

  • Is Celerly only for everything Resellers?

    Celerly was built off the idea that inventory intake should be easy, so everything works from the photo forward. No bar code scanning. No silly AI suggestions on what to buy or pass. Take a photo of something that catches your eye. Do a little research like eBay sold comps and Google Lens, and decide whether it’s worthwhile. If it is, buy it! It’s no part of your inventory. (Just to be clear…the buying doesn’t happen through Celerly.) 

    This workflow is customized for the everything reseller, but it can work just as well for the specialist. For example books, clothing, trading cards.
